Teradata performance tuning and optimization Teradata performance tuning and optimization collecting statistics Explain Statements Avoid Product Joins when possible select appropriate primary index to avoid skewness in storage Avoid Redistributions when possible Use sub-selects instead of big "IN" lists Use drived tables Use GROUP BY instead of DISTINCT ( GROUP BY sorts the data locally on the VPROC. DISTINCT sorts the data after it is redistributed) Use Compression on large tables ----------------------------------- How teradata makes sure that there are no duplicate rows being inserted when its a SET table? Teradata redirects the new inserted row as per its Primary Index to the target AMP (Access Module Processor) on the basis of its row hash value, and if it find same row hash value in that AMP then it start comparing the whole row, and find out if duplicate. When the target table has UPI(Unique Primary Index) then the duplicate row is rejected with an error.
